Output ff9578486adef963239879dce8fe4a6fb2cc02163b36c1d7651d4266281f93f8:6

value
3594628
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c6e6dd0ef68d39914a21e6effdf931abcfc0aca2 OP_EQUALVERIFY OP_CHECKSIG
address
1K8hMfJBXkvUJeSENCpjHUXra3KsiiJDfc
transaction
ff9578486adef963239879dce8fe4a6fb2cc02163b36c1d7651d4266281f93f8
spent
true